Output 6dd893d00cca931024c4e3822636b03460fea210312989c9a2f151712a8bbef8:1

value
50000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f94e176d4979e46e044b19d86060e23d24ec4a56 OP_EQUAL
address
3QRDjCifkaA9CDHqjshmynDd23He4YLrgr
transaction
6dd893d00cca931024c4e3822636b03460fea210312989c9a2f151712a8bbef8
confirmations
436465
spent
true